A combined total of $46,000 is invested in two bonds that pay 4% and
9.5% simple interest. The annual interest is $3,490.00. How much is
invested in each bond?



Sagot :


Answer: 4%-16000 and 9.5%-30000

Why:

1) x+y=46000

x=46000-y

2) 4%x+9,5%y=3490;

4x + 9.5y=349000; so 4*(46000-y)+9.5y=349000;

5.5y=165000

y=30000

x=46000-30000=16000
